- Summary:
- Forty-year-old academic economist Miklos Nemeth was more surprised than anyone when he was named Prime Minister of Hungary. It was 1989, and the Communist system was on the brink of collapse. Nemeth, an outsider with few friends in the Party, was charged with the seemingly impossible task of saving the country from bankruptcy. This films depicts how this political ingenue guided Hungary through its most critical period in three decades--and laid the groundwork for the fall of the Berlin Wall.
